Don't be the guy this story would be about:


Oct 18, 2017, 9:06 PM

Wow, he took over Clemson and led them to 6 consecutive 10+win seasons, two 14-win seasons in a row, three Orange Bowls, a Fiesta Bowl, three ACC Championships, another ACC title game appearance, two National Championship game appearances, a national championship, had won 40 of the last 43 games, was 6-0 and #2 in the nation, he lost at Syracuse in an upset and fulfilled an already planned trip to his alma mater the next day to recognize a national championship and salute his beloved coach he and his team had worked hard to earn, and the fans wanted to run him off at Clemson. Wanted to flat run him off.

To the original poster, Don't be that person.


I wonder if Nebraska wanted to run off Tom Osborne when Cuse upset #1 Nebraska in Syracuse on September 29, 1984. I'll be they're glad they didn't because 10 years later, he won back to back national titles in 1994 and 1995.

Steve Spurrier was on Packer today and he said one year one of his Florida teams beat Alabama 35-0 in the Swamp and then they went up to Syracuse and got beat 38-21. Every dog has his day.
